Shivamogga, often affectionately known as the Gateway to Malnad, is a picturesque city nestled in the central part of the state of Karnataka. Resting on the fertile banks of the Tunga River, this destination is renowned for its lush green landscapes, rolling hills, and abundant areca nut plantations. It serves as a perfect blend of cultural heritage and natural beauty, offering a serene escape for travelers exploring India.
With a population of approximately 322,000 residents, the city maintains a lively yet welcoming atmosphere. The region enjoys a tropical climate, characterized by pleasant winters and a vibrant monsoon season that brings the surrounding nature to life. Visitors interested in the past can delve into the rich history of Shivamogga, which was once a significant stronghold of the illustrious Keladi Nayaka dynasty.
Nature enthusiasts and adventure seekers will find plenty to admire here. The city is the ideal base for visiting the majestic Jog Falls, one of the highest waterfalls in the country, located nearby. Within the city limits, the Shivappa Nayaka Palace stands as an architectural marvel constructed from rosewood, while the Sakrebailu Elephant Camp offers a unique opportunity to observe and interact with gentle giants in their natural habitat.
